Exterior design
trends
Dual tonality is
the one of the strongest trends. The
unique idea of splitting the car body into two tone for highlighting features,
elements and details . Car models like Renault Captur, Kia provo and Pininfarina Sergio concept have applied
dual tonality in a new way. This kind of
treatment gives cars more lighter feeling and adds more dynamism.
Graphics line gap
feature is a new trend that we have seen. Interestingly in the past gaps or
larger spaces in between body panels was
seen as bad manufacturing as well as design quality. However treating gaps
between body panels as graphic element is more intelligent way of disguising
them. We have seen supercars like La
Ferrari, MclarenP1 treating their
bodywork in this new way. Surely it will inspire automakers to look at this new
trend.
Lamps with vent is
new way to make cars look clean and simple. With ever-growing technology
complicated details like this are possible and designers can go crazy with
their design ideas.
Interior Design trend
Floating interior
surfaces is the only strong design trend we have seen in the interiors.
This days interiors gaining more
attention in terms of surfaces treatment and complex forms. One of the
designers dream is to create to interiors with layered sensuality, with this
advancement in design engineering , ideas like this will take shape in future.
